Tristan Leigh (born April 28, 2003) is an American college football offensive tackle for the Clemson Tigers.

Contents

Early life

Leigh was born on April 28, 2003, and grew up in Fairfax, Virginia. [1] He grew up playing soccer and basketball, later starting to play football after his mother initially was unwilling to let him. [2] [3] He attended Robinson Secondary School in Fairfax where he played football and was a top offensive tackle, receiving his first scholarship offer in January 2019. [4] [5] He was named first-team All-DMV by NBC Sports Washington and the Virginia High School Player of the Year. [1] He was invited to the Polynesian Bowl and the All-American Bowl. [1] [6] A five-star recruit and one of the top 15 overall players in the 2021 recruiting class, he committed to play college football for the Clemson Tigers. [3] [7]

College career

As a freshman for the Tigers in 2021, Leigh redshirted and appeared in two games. [8] He appeared in five games the following season. [8] He won a starting role in 2023, appearing in 13 games while starting 11. [1] He then started 12 games during the 2024 season and helped Clemson win the Atlantic Coast Conference (ACC) Championship Game. [1] He announced a return for a final season in 2025. [9]
